Our Ink Imperial Stout aged for three months in Sherry Barrels for a rich, full-bodied and creamy mouthfeel with milk chocolate and caramel undertones.
Medals: Silver, 2015 Great American Beer Festival

Bottle shared by Mike at Logan's. Pours black, with a small, bubbly, beige head. The aroma is coffee, rye, oak, vanilla, and sweet cherries. Some notes of toffee and caramel in the finish. Very sweet and dessert-like, with just a touch of bitterness to balanced it well. Very heavy body, with a smooth, velvety, rich mouthfeel. This is an amazingly smooth and decadent beer. The sherry treatment just tops it off.

Bottle shared during RBWG 2016 - huge thanks to PHale. Pours oily black-brown with a frothy khaki head. Ashy roast in the nose, torched wood, iodine, dried dark berries. Medium to heavy sweet flavor with some prominent woody notes, baking cocoa, roast, cherry, raspberry. Full bodied, a little oily and chewy, with fine carbonation. Warming finish, with some dark fruits, berries, chocolate. Good stuff. Interesting barrel character. Opens up nicely.
